云计算环境中虚拟机内存自适应调节算法研究
Research of Adaptive Virtual Machine Memory Scheduling Algorithm in Cloud Computing Environment
摘要
Abstract
Resource of Xen virtual machines has been fixed when booted.However,some virtual machines have to use swap space because of the lack of memory while there is idle memory in other virtual machines,which reduces the usage efficiency of memory.There has been the design of memory scheduling algorithm among virtual machines in the previous research,but the scheduling algorithm is inefficient without the consideration of swap.On the foundation of the previous research,this paper puts forward a more reasonable scheduling algorithm that combines swap and the usage of memory to adjust the allocation of memory in virtual machines.The algorithm is also designed on the theory of the idle memory tax proposed by Carl.Firstly,the range of the adjustment will be settled based on the usage of memory and swap.Then the object memory will be calculated in the range.Compared with the previous algorithm,the improved algorithm has been proved to be more effective in experiments.关键词
